Alsa
Alain Schroeder
alain at mini.gt.owl.de
Sat Jan 29 14:56:22 CET 2000
On Thu, Jan 27, 2000 at 07:44:49PM +0100, Peter Lohmann wrote:
> Hallo!
>
> Ich hab hier in meinem Notebook eine Crystal 4237 PNP Soundkarte
> und versuche die mit Alsa zum Laufen zu bekommen. Wie gesagt, ich versuche:
>
Content-Description: alsa.txt
>
> # --- BEGIN: Generated by ALSACONF, do not edit. ---
> # --- ALSACONF verion 0.4.2 ---
> alias char-major-116 snd
> alias snd-card-0 snd-card-cs4236
> alias char-major-14 soundcore
> alias sound-slot-0 snd-card-0
> alias sound-service-0-0 snd-mixer-oss
> alias sound-service-0-1 snd-seq-oss
> alias sound-service-0-3 snd-pcm1-oss
> alias sound-service-0-12 snd-pcm1-oss
> options snd snd_major=116 snd_cards_limit=1 snd_device_mode=0660 snd_device_gid=29 snd_device_uid=0
> options snd-card-cs4236 snd_index=1 snd_id=CARD_1 snd_port=0x534 snd_cport=0x120 snd_mpu_port=0x300 snd_fm_port=-1 snd_irq=7 snd_mpu_irq=9 snd_dma1=0 snd_dma2=1
> # --- END: Generated by ALSACONF, do not edit. ---
Sieht ok aus.
Content-Description: pnpdump.txt
<pnpdump.txt>
# Board 1 has serial identifier 33 ff ff ff ff 37 47 63 0e
# (DEBUG)
(READPORT 0x0273)
(ISOLATE PRESERVE)
(IDENTIFY *)
(VERBOSITY 2)
(CONFLICT (IO FATAL)(IRQ FATAL)(DMA FATAL)(MEM FATAL)) # or WARNING
# Card 1: (serial identifier 33 ff ff ff ff 37 47 63 0e)
# ANSI string -->Crystal Codec(DAEWOO)<--
(CONFIGURE CSC4737/-1 (LD 0
# ANSI string -->WSS/SB<--
(DMA 0 (CHANNEL 1)) # 0, 1, 3
(DMA 1 (CHANNEL 0)) # 0, 1, 3
(INT 0 (IRQ 7 (MODE +E))) # 5, 7, 9, 11, 12, 15
(IO 0 (SIZE 4) (BASE 0x0534)) # 534 - ffc
(IO 1 (SIZE 4) (BASE 0x0388)) # 388 - 3f8
(IO 2 (SIZE 16) (BASE 0x0220)) # 220 - 300
(NAME "CSC4737/-1[0]{WSS/SB }")
(ACT Y)
))
(CONFIGURE CSC4737/-1 (LD 1
# ANSI string -->GAME<--
(IO 0 (SIZE 8) (BASE 0x0200)) # 200, 208
(NAME "CSC4737/-1[1]{GAME }")
(ACT Y)
))
(CONFIGURE CSC4737/-1 (LD 2
# ANSI string -->CTRL<--
(IO 0 (SIZE 8) (BASE 0x0120)) # 120 - 3f8
(NAME "CSC4737/-1[2]{CTRL }")
(ACT Y)
))
(WAITFORKEY)
</pnpdump.txt>
Wenn du isapnp mit dieser Konfiguration fütterst und dann ALSA lädst, sollte
das funktionieren - ggf mußt du die beiden DMA austauschen, oder andere Werte
raussuchen (0 = ist afaik deaktiviert).
Bye,
- -- Alain -- -
--
Hi! I'm a .signature virus! Copy me into your ~/.signature to help me spread!
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 232 bytes
Desc: not available
URL: <http://lug-owl.de/pipermail/linux/attachments/20000129/d9b0de7e/attachment.sig>
More information about the Linux
mailing list